2. IT Support, Technology Consulting, and Repair

The world becomes more technologically inclined every single day. That’s why companies in IT support are some of the most profitable businesses. There’s a very high demand in every industry for people who know how to deliver tech support. These professionals tend to charge high fees for their services. And if you can also offer tech consulting, you’ll get even more clients and may be able to charge more. If you’re going to be providing IT support, there’s an important issue to consider. When you work on a client’s computer, things could go wrong. For example, the system could crash, or you may inadvertently cause some damage. The customer may hold you responsible for these problems. To save yourself from paying the client or entering into an expensive legal battle, consider buying the correct type of insurance. Look for a Technology errors and omissions policy that covers the risks you could face as a tech support provider.

4. Accounting and Tax Preparation

Tax preparation has a market size of $11 billion. 130,179 tax preparation businesses employ 301,578 people. This category also encompasses payroll services and bookkeeping. Most people would rather pay someone than do it themselves or learn how to do it. So anything from a small accounting firm to a tax accountant will always be in style. Remember that to carry out tax preparation work, you need to meet the IRS and your state’s requirements. Most commonly, you will need a Preparer tax identification number (PTIN) and a license to prepare tax returns.

26. Travel Agency

A travel agency is a great business opportunity because everyone loves traveling. You’ll help people get their plane tickets or arrange for other transportation options, hotel reservations, tours, and much more. You could open up a home-based travel agency by tying up with a host agency. But, first, you should obtain your IATA (International Air Transport Association) and your ARC (Airlines Reporting Corporation) numbers. These numbers allow you to issue air tickets while earning a commission.
#CaminoTip Don’t forget to get the necessary certifications.
Or, if setting up an agency seems too cumbersome, you can just set up a travel planning business. Think of a travel planner as an assistant that helps people plan the perfect holidays. You won’t be able to offer all the services people need (like buying their plane tickets), but it’s certainly a great business model.

34. Handyman and Maintenance

You might not think this one would be one of the most profitable businesses, but it is. There is, and there will always be, a demand for people who can repair lighting, fix plumbing problems, clean gutters and pools, paint fences, replace doors and carpets, you name it. While the hourly rate for property maintenance is not high, you can have your own business if you live in an area where apartment complexes and rentals abound. How much can you expect to earn if you work in property maintenance? According to the US Bureau of Labor Statistics, general maintenance, and repair worker salaries can average $18.79 per hour. That’s $39,080 every year. Handypersons are usually paid by the hour and can have multiple clients at once. You can also partner with larger handyperson companies as an employee or franchisee partner, meaning they will generally take a percentage of your pay but give you loads of work in return. Here are some tips to get you started as a handyperson:
  • Estimate how much money you’ll need to start. Budget for about $2,000 to $5,000.
  • Check out the websites of businesses that provide handyman services. You can offer to do similar work. You’ll also get an idea about the rates to charge.
  • Consider creating a website. It can be the best way to get new customers. A website also helps to establish your credibility.

35. Property Management

Property management is a lucrative but arduous business that requires time, effort, and resources. It’s tricky to start up your own property management company. However, it’s possible to join the ranks of successful business owners. A property management company is responsible for taking care of and managing a rented or leased property. Just to name a few things, they must:
  • collect rent
  • handle maintenance issues
  • hire contractors
  • ensure a tenant receives their security deposit after their lease expires

42. Legal Services Business

The profitability of a legal services business depends on factors such as the size and reputation of the firm, the expertise and experience of the legal professionals, the types of clients served, and the efficiency of operations. Established law firms with a strong client base, prestigious reputation, and expertise in high-demand areas of law often have the potential for higher profitability. These firms can command higher fees and attract clients with complex and high-value legal matters. Additionally, specialized areas of law, such as corporate law, intellectual property, and litigation, can offer higher profit margins due to the premium rates charged for specialized legal services. Smaller law firms or those targeting niche markets may face more challenges in generating substantial profits. Moreover, the cost structure of legal services businesses, including overhead costs such as office space, technology, and personnel, can impact profitability. Effective management of costs, efficient operations, and the ability to attract and retain high-quality clients are key factors in maximizing the profitability of a legal services business.

Top Industries By Net Profit Margin

Industry Net Profit Margin (%)
Pharmaceuticals 15.3%
Technology (Software) 13.2%
Real Estate Development 11.5%
Internet Services & Retailing 10.4%
Biotechnology 10.2%
Financial Services 9.8%
Health Services 9.4%
Utilities 9.2%
Software & IT Services 9.0%
Consumer Products & Services 8.7%
Please keep in mind that these percentages represent the average net profit margins within each industry. The profitability of a business can vary greatly depending on various factors, such as location, competition, market conditions, and individual company performance. How to Start a Profitable Business: 5 steps

Find the perfect idea and research

A business is only as good as its product or service. You must spend some time brainstorming to develop a great product that isn’t readily available in the marketplace but that people are willing to buy.

Plan the business

You should write a business plan that includes all your research and ideas on turning your product into a profitable venture. Your plan will help you justify the risk associated with such an endeavor.

Secure startup financing

Once you have figured out the costs of making, marketing and selling your product, figure out what it will cost to get started. Don’t forget to include startup costs of inventory, equipment, and rent/mortgage payments on your business space. Then, if you don’t have the capital, apply for a business loan.

Comply with legal requirements

Once you have gotten your startup financing, now is the time to make sure you comply with all laws and regulations for your business. This means setting up a business structure. Depending on your locality, you will also need insurance policies, licenses, and other specialized permits.

Open your business

Congratulations! It’s time to open your doors and start selling. Identify your target customers and create a sales plan to reach them using social media, ads, promotions, etc.
